![]() This works fine in IE all versions with the same code. GET By jQuery Api Ajax Codeigniter Load Content on Scroll Down Ajax Codeigniter Load More on Page Scroll From Scratch Ajax Image Upload into Database & Folder Codeigniter Ajax Multiple Image Upload. I'm trying to print a pop up window using the following code : ames'cInitChecksWindowIFrame'.focus() window.print() When I view the print page the html of parent page is also passed along with pop-up window in Chrome. This would be an example of how I have done it, simplified of course. 3Way to Remove Duplicates From Array In JavaScript 8 Simple Free Seo Tools to Instantly Improve Your Marketing Today 419 Status Code Laravel Ajax. You can't actually use JavaScript to issue a print of the contents of an iframe of a remote website, so I'm going to assume you were just using as an example for a page that is actually hosted on your website, like an invoice or something ) ![]() However, if I right click on the page in the iFrame and try to print I get only the visible content (and the scroll bars) instead of the entire content of the iFrame (I don't think I can just have a function that opens my page in a new window since most of the content is dynamic or the results of searches that have been run against a database).ĭoes anyone know how to get this iFrame tab to print it's entire contents when I right click and select print? I created a couple of CSS class for printing and used the bod圜fg property of the Panel object to finally get the necessary CSS to apply and the pages to print correctly.I'd like to print the contents of a tab containing an iFrame. Coupled with the way ExtJS renders content by nesting DIV even setting overflow to visible on the body tag of my popup window’s HTML did not yield the necessary results. It took me a while to figure out that this was due to the overflow:hidden CSS property set by the ExtJS stylesheet on most DIVs. The second issue i ran into once the layout was completed and rendered fine was that only the first of my two print pages would actually print content. The Ext.us.Printer also comes with a print stylesheet that i used as a base for my own. Note that, because of dimensions requirements being different for a print layout, and also display columns requirement being different between the application grid and its printed version, the more convenient resolution was to create a second hidden gridpanel within the application, with its dimensions and columns optimized for printing. The grid being part of my print page, i just modified its GridRenderer object to render the grid as an HTML table to the DOM. For that, i used the excellent Ext.ux.Printer extension by Ed Spencer that i had to tweak it a bit to get it to work with that i was trying to do since it is designed to print a grid within a popup window. As far as the data itself, i could simply grab everything i needed by referencing the Ext object in the parent window: No magic from ExtJS here, i referenced a PDF version of the application to redesign the UI for printing purposes. My application being composed of a mixture of form fields, text and grids within the same screen, the number one issue here for me was how to show that same information in a printable format. Overall, my strategy was to bring up the print layout within a popup window and call the window.print() command once rendering was done. ![]() This is the unminified version of ext-all.js for debugging purpose. This file contains all the code minified with no comments in the file. I was surprised to find out that there was no official print stylesheet for ExtJS. This is the core file which contains all the functionalities to run the application. One of the features i had to implement in one of the ExtJS application I’ve worked on is printing.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|